{"product_id":"antique-art-objects-22","title":"MUSICIAN AND DANCER FIGURES, Gray earthenware with slip and pigments, Tang Dynasty（618-907CE）","description":"\u003cp\u003eThis is a figurine of a female musician holding an instrument and performing. Traces of red and green pigments remain in various areas. In the Tang Dynasty, the capital cities of Chang'an and Luoyang flourished as international hubs due to East-West trade, where music and dance from Iranian Sogdian and other Central Asian cultures became popular. As a result, numerous figurines depicting musical performances were created, offering a glimpse into the vibrant and cosmopolitan court culture of the Tang Dynasty.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e neck has been restored.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"ROCANIIRU COLLECTION","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44832306463001,"sku":null,"price":41.95,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0688\/9911\/1193\/products\/rcnir-2023-00005367.jpg?v=1752156838","url":"https:\/\/rcnir.com\/en-ie\/products\/antique-art-objects-22","provider":"入蘆花（ロカニイル）","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
